Sonia Rykiel Pour H&M Preview
Director of Sonia Rykiel, Nathalie Rykiel shows a back-stage view of the upcoming collection for Sonia Rykiel Pour H&M. The line features lovely knit sweaters with stripes, bows and ruffles to wear to the office, or you can show off your sexy shoulders with a wide-neck sweater dress, perfect for a hot date night. For a more casual look, you can pair the tops or sweaters with the cute leggings or the shorts.
If you weren’t able to pick up any items from the lingerie collection last month, definitely check out the new knit pieces and accessories to update your wardrobe for wallet-friendly prices. The pullover sweaters start at $29.95. The knitwear collection will be available in about 250 H&M stores, debuting on February 20.
